    Why Infographics?

    Around 50% of human brain is dedicated to visual empathyReason why you registbackground of a billboard faster than the Singular line of Brand/Message pasted the

    This is because images are processed as a whole or in one frame, compared to Text wprocessed Linearly along with semantics

    Furthermore, it is also estimated that 65% of Indian population are visual sympathizakin to the auditory or kinesthetic senses

    All these followed by the newest trend of Social Media and Internet awareness makea lucrative tool to reach to or advertise.

    A timeline is a way of depicting a list of events in chronological order.

    It is created using long bars labelled with dates and the event printed alongs

    & event label may interchange)

    While showing time on a specific scale on an axis, a timeline can be used to v

    between events, durations (Like lifetimes, wars etc)

    Advantages:

    Provides a sequential approach to a series of events; thus depicting c

    Used extensively while making case studies for Consultants

    Used in trend analysis by Marketers or Market researchers Also used to showcase History of a Person/Event

    Best usage: Displaying project artifacts & deadlines
